Bothwell is a small rural community with limited accommodation and food outlets. Nonetheless, some accommodation is available in the township as well as in nearby towns. Bothwell's hotel will be prepared for the event and will be able to cater for those looking for the kind of 'Pub Meal' country hotels are famous for. There is also a bakery and general store in the township and they will be able to provide takeaway and light meals, coffee etc. as they have in previous years.

ACCOMMODATION
COMMERCIAL ACCOMMODATION is available.
Refer to Travelways at www.travelways.com.au or Jasons at www.jasons.com or book through
The Central Tasmanian Tourism Centre, Oatlands Ph. 03 62541212.
The Bothwell Caravan Park has powered and unpowered sites and can be booked through the Central Highlands Council Ph. 03 62595503
Commercial Accommodation is also available at the following neighbouring towns:
Kempton, Oatlands, Hamilton, Ouse, Jericho, Waddamana and Miena all about 30 min from Bothwell. Refer to MAPS on this site
 
PRIVATE ACCOMMODATION is available on application for full registrants only,
Home B & B, or Shearer's Quarters (basic facilities, does not include bedclothes or linen).
 
ACTIVITIES CATERING ARRANGEMENTS–– BOOKINGS ARE ESSENTIAL
Thursday 1st March. ...... SET UP DAY
Meet and Greet: 5.30 to 6.30pm at the Bothwell Town Hall; welcoming drink, biscuits and cheese.
Dinner: at the Bothwell Town Hall, Soup, Cold meats, Salad and Dessert, Coffee/ tea $18.00
Beverages available
Friday 2nd March
Dinner and Live Show by the Riverside Arts Club at the Bothwell Town Hall at 7pm
Soup, Roast meat and Vegetables, Dessert Coffee/tea. $25.00 with the entertainment during the meal –
N.B. Vegetarian options are available for all meals please advise on your Registration Form and bookings are advisable.
Saturday 3rd March
BBQ in Queens Park 6.00pm $10.00, followed at 7.00 pm by The SPINin's famous “Concert” in the Town Hall – N.B. Vegetarian options are available for all meals please advise on your Registration Form
